Albania - Sugar Crops Production
Since 2014, Albania Sugar Crops Production decreased by 5.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 112 among other countries in Sugar Crops Production at 28 Thousand Metric Tons. Albania is overtaken by Iraq, which was ranked number 111 with 40 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Malaysia at 27 Thousand Metric Tons. Brazil lead the ranking with 752,439 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is +0.8% versus 2018. India, Thailand and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kazakhstan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+85.6% per year, while Afghanistan recorded the worst performance at -21.3% per year.
